I never tried that - dmd only looks for /etc/dmd.conf not for
~/.dmd.conf or dmd.conf in the same dir as the binary.
(having multiple dmd versions or a non-root installation in that
setting is a pitta)
This doesn't work:
/etc/dmd.conf: PATH=/opt/dmd/cage:$PATH
This does work
/etc/dmd.conf: PATH=/opt/dmd/cage:%PATH%
A mixed Linux-Windows notation in a Linux config file :D
